3D Printing in Dental Surgery



To improve the field of dental surgery, you can discover the subtopic of 3D printing in oral surgery. This cutting-edge technology has the prospective to transform the method oral cosmetic surgeons operate and treat clients. Below are 4 vital methods which 3D printing is shaping the area:

- ** Custom-made Surgical Guides **: 3D printing enables the creation of extremely precise and patient-specific surgical guides, enhancing the accuracy and performance of treatments.

- ** Implant Prosthetics **: With 3D printing, oral specialists can produce customized implant prosthetics that completely fit an individual's special composition, leading to far better results and person fulfillment.

- ** Bone Grafting **: 3D printing makes it possible for the production of patient-specific bone grafts, minimizing the need for traditional implanting methods and boosting recovery and recuperation time.

- ** Education and Educating **: 3D printing can be made use of to produce reasonable medical versions for academic objectives, enabling dental doctors to exercise intricate treatments prior to performing them on people.

With its potential to improve accuracy, modification, and training, 3D printing is an interesting development in the field of dental surgery.

Minimally Intrusive Techniques



To further advance the field of dental surgery, welcome the possibility of minimally invasive techniques that can substantially profit both doctors and individuals alike.

Minimally invasive techniques are reinventing the area by lowering surgical trauma, lessening post-operative discomfort, and accelerating the healing procedure. These methods involve using smaller incisions and specialized instruments to carry out treatments with accuracy and effectiveness.

By using innovative imaging technology, such as cone beam of light calculated tomography (CBCT), doctors can properly prepare and perform surgeries with marginal invasiveness.

Additionally, making use of lasers in dental surgery permits exact cells cutting and coagulation, leading to lessened bleeding and lowered recovery time.

With minimally invasive methods, clients can experience quicker recovery, reduced scarring, and improved outcomes, making it a necessary element of the future of dental surgery.
